首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JavaScript:将值记录到控制台时触发事件

在JavaScript中,我们可以使用console对象将值记录到浏览器的控制台。当我们在代码中使用console.log()方法时,它会将指定的值输出到控制台。

触发事件是指在特定条件下执行特定的代码。在这种情况下,当将值记录到控制台时,不会直接触发事件,而是在特定的代码块中执行。

以下是一个示例代码,演示如何将值记录到控制台并触发事件:

代码语言:txt
复制
// 将值记录到控制台
console.log("Hello, World!");

// 触发事件
function myFunction() {
  // 执行特定的代码
  console.log("Event triggered!");
}

// 调用函数以触发事件
myFunction();

在上面的示例中,我们首先使用console.log()方法将字符串"Hello, World!"记录到控制台。然后,我们定义了一个名为myFunction()的函数,其中包含了要在事件触发时执行的代码。最后,我们通过调用myFunction()函数来触发事件,并将字符串"Event triggered!"记录到控制台。

这种技术在调试和开发过程中非常有用,可以帮助我们检查代码中的变量值、调试错误以及跟踪代码执行流程。

对于JavaScript开发者来说,熟悉控制台的使用是非常重要的。除了console.log()方法,控制台还提供了其他有用的方法,如console.error()、console.warn()和console.info()等,可以根据需要选择使用。

腾讯云提供了云开发服务,其中包括云函数和云数据库等功能,可以帮助开发者快速构建和部署基于云的应用程序。您可以通过以下链接了解更多关于腾讯云云开发的信息:

请注意,以上答案仅供参考,具体的技术实现和推荐产品可能因个人需求和偏好而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

这10个JavaScript 知识点,建议每个前端开发者都要深入理解

调用了Promise.resolve().then()链,一个回调添加到微任务队列中。微任务(如Promise)比常规任务/事件具有更高的优先级。 程序“End”日志记录到控制台。...事件循环检查调用栈并发现它为空。 事件循环然后检查任务队列,并选择执行最早的任务(第一个setTimeout()回调)。 “Timeout 1”日志记录到控制台。...事件循环再次检查调用栈并发现它为空。 事件循环继续处理任务队列,并执行第二个setTimeout()回调。 “Timeout 2”日志记录到控制台事件循环再次检查调用栈并发现它为空。...接下来,事件循环检查微任务队列,并执行Promise.resolve().then()回调。 “Promise resolved”日志记录到控制台。...在每次迭代中,循环等待生成器产生的下一个,并将其赋值给value变量。然后,我们value记录到控制台

21230

分享 7 个你可能还未使用过的 JavaScript Web API

2、全屏 Web API 在我们希望网页中的某个元素进入全屏模式,全屏 API 在 JavaScript 中非常有用。因此,该 API 允许我们网页或元素切换到全屏模式,为用户提供更好的体验。...然后,我们从position对象的coords属性中访问经度和纬度坐标,并将它们记录到控制台中。 接下来,在错误回调函数中,我们处理在地理位置获取过程中出现的任何错误,并将错误消息记录到控制台中。...在测试中,我得到了一个为 5.65 的结果。然而,你的结果可能会因为你的互联网速度和所使用的浏览器而有所不同。你可以通过访问浏览器控制台自行进行实验。...当有识别结果可用时,触发 onresult 事件。 我们从 event.results 中获取识别到的语音的文本,并将其记录到控制台中。...如果在语音识别过程中出现错误,会触发 onerror 事件,并将错误记录到控制台中。

27520
  • 如何使用谷歌浏览器 Chrome 更好地调试

    顾名思义,monitor() 函数是此类控制台函数之一,用于监视特定函数以了解何时调用该函数以及在调用该函数哪些参数传递给该函数。...monitorEvents() - 监控 DOM 对象事件 此函数用于监视 DOM 中的对象是否有特定事件事件。当在指定对象上触发事件,该函数立即将事件和对象输出到控制台。...当指定对象上发生任何指定事件,Event 对象将被记录到控制台。要监视的事件可以是特定事件事件数组或映射到预定义集合的通用事件“类型”。...table() - 数组输出为表 从数据库或外部 API 获取数据,它通常以对象数组的形式出现。...返回的是一个对象,其中包含每个注册的事件类型(如点击、按键等)的数组。每个成员数组都包含该事件类型的所有事件,并且可以扩展以探索它们各自的属性,例如它们触发的关联函数。

    3.6K30

    ArcGIS Maps SDK for JavaScript系列之二:认识Map和MapView

    MapView的on()方法常用的注册事件如下: “click”:当用户在地图上单击触发。 “double-click”:当用户在地图上双击触发。 “drag”:当用户在地图上拖拽触发。...// 在地图上按下任意指针设备按钮(鼠标按钮、触摸屏等)触发事件 console.log('pointer-down 事件触发') }); view.on('pointer-move'...', (event) => { // 释放任意指针设备按钮(鼠标按钮、触摸屏等)触发事件 console.log('pointer-up 事件触发') }); view.on(...然后,使用view.toMap(screenPoint)方法页面像素坐标转换为地图上的经纬度坐标。最后,获取到的经纬度打印到控制台。...接下来,使用view.toScreen(mapPoint)地图坐标点转换为页面上的像素坐标。最后,获取到的像素坐标在控制台打印出来。

    64030

    分享一些Chrome开发工具的用法

    函数监听器 monitor(function)/unmonitor(function) monitor(function),当调用指定的函数,会将一条消息记录到控制台,该消息指示调用时传递给该函数的函数名和参数...]),当指定的对象上发生指定的事件之一,事件对象将被记录到控制台。...分析程序性能 在 DevTools 窗口控制台中,调用 console.profile()开启一个 JavaScript CPU 分析器.结束分析器直接调用 console.profileEnd()....重写 Overrides 在 Chrome DevTools 上调试 css 或 JavaScript ,修改的属性在重新刷新页面,所有的修改都会被重置。...实时表达式 Live Expression 从 chrome70 起,我们可以在控制台上方可以放一个动态表达式,用于实时监控它的。Live Expression 的执行频率是 250 毫秒。

    1K20

    在 Chrome DevTools 中调试 JavaScript

    控制台 控制台除了查看 console.log() 消息以外,还可以使用控制台对任意 JavaScript 语句求值。...事件侦听器 在触发 click 等事件后运行的代码中 异常 在引发已捕获或未捕获异常的代码行中 函数 任何时候调用特定函数 1....Subtree modifications: 在移除或添加当前所选节点的子级,或更改子级内容触发这类断点。在子级节点属性发生变化或对当前所选节点进行任何更改时不会触发这类断点。...Attributes modifications:在当前所选节点上添加或移除属性,或属性发生变化时触发这类断点。 Node Removal:在移除当前选定的节点时会触发。 4....事件侦听器断点 如果想要暂停触发事件后运行的事件侦听器代码,可以使用事件侦听器断点。 您可以选择 click 等特定事件或所有鼠标事件事件类别。

    5K20

    2024年必备:每个前端开发者都应掌握的Chrome开发工具调试技巧

    在本文中,我介绍如何利用Chrome控制台中的快捷工具来加速网络应用的调试工作。例如,当你需要快速获取DOM检视器中选中的元素,你可以使用这些快捷工具,而不是进行繁琐的鼠标点击或长代码输入。...同样地,values 函数提供了一种高效的方式来打印特定对象的所有: 这行代码输出 doc 对象的所有,例如 [100, "My document", "A4", 100]。...但如果我们想知道特定事件何时被触发,又不使用DevTools GUI中基于GUI的事件监听器断点功能,该怎么办呢?...$_ 变量是一个非常实用的快捷方式,它返回在控制台上执行的上一个表达式的返回。这在进行连续的命令执行和结果检查特别有用。...例如,你可以直接在控制台上修改DOM元素的数据属性: 最后,Chrome控制台的 copy 函数允许你JavaScript对象或其他数据直接复制到系统剪贴板。这在需要快速共享或移动数据特别有用。

    51710

    深入理解JavaScript中的事件传播机制:事件冒泡和事件捕获

    前言在JavaScript中,事件冒泡和事件捕获是两种不同的事件传播方式。当一个事件触发,它会从最内层的元素开始,然后逐级向外传播,直到最外层的元素。...在这个过程中,事件会经过每一个元素,直到它到达最内层的元素。在本文中,我们详细了解事件冒泡和事件捕获,并探讨它们在JavaScript中的实现以及如何使用它们。...;});当你单击按钮控制台输出以下内容:Button Clicked!Inner Div Clicked!Outer Div Clicked!...;}, true);当你单击按钮控制台输出以下内容:Outer Div Clicked!Inner Div Clicked!...我们还使用事件捕获方式注册了两个事件处理程序,一个用于内部div,另一个用于外部div。当你单击按钮控制台输出以下内容:Outer Div Clicked!Inner Div Clicked!

    1.8K21

    「硬核JS」一次搞懂JS运行机制

    当对应的事件符合触发条件被触发,该线程会把事件添加到待处理队列的队尾,等待JS引擎的处理 因为JS是单线程,所以这些待处理队列中的事件都得排队等待JS引擎处理 定时触发器线程 setInterval与...setTimeout所在线程 浏览器定时计数器并不是由JavaScript引擎计数的(因为JavaScript引擎是单线程的,如果处于阻塞线程状态就会影响计时的准确) 通过单独线程来计时并触发定时(计时完毕后...请求线程 在XMLHttpRequest在连接后是通过浏览器新开一个线程请求 检测到状态变更,如果设置有回调函数,异步线程就产生状态变更事件这个回调再放入事件队列中再由JavaScript引擎执行...请求线程发送网络请求,请求成功后 httpCallback 这个回调交由事件触发线程处理,事件触发线程收到 httpCallback 这个回调后把它加入到事件触发线程所管理的事件队列中等待执行 再接着执行...console.log('我是同步任务2') 至此主线程执行栈中执行完毕,JS引擎线程已经空闲,开始向事件触发线程发起询问,询问事件触发线程的事件队列中是否有需要执行的回调函数,如果有事件队列中的回调事件加入执行栈中

    2K10

    0202年了, Chrome DevTools 你还只会console.log吗 ?

    函数监听器 monitor(function)/unmonitor(function) monitor(function),当调用指定的函数,会将一条消息记录到控制台,该消息指示调用时传递给该函数的函数名和参数...]),当指定的对象上发生指定的事件之一,事件对象将被记录到控制台。...事件类型可以指定为单个事件事件数组。 unmonitorevent (object[, events])停止监视指定对象和事件事件。 ? monitorevents 11....重写 Overrides 在 Chrome DevTools 上调试 css 或 JavaScript ,修改的属性在重新刷新页面,所有的修改都会被重置。...实时表达式 Live Expression 从 chrome70 起,我们可以在控制台上方可以放一个动态表达式,用于实时监控它的。Live Expression 的执行频率是 250 毫秒。

    1.2K20

    保存用户信息到本地存储

    定义保存数据函数:saveData函数会从输入框中获取值,并使用localStorage.setItem方法保存到本地存储中。...监听输入框输入事件:通过addEventListener方法,saveData函数绑定到name、email和weburl输入框的input事件上,当输入框中输入信息自动保存数据。...页面加载恢复数据:使用window.onload事件,在页面加载完成后检查本地存储中是否存在之前保存的数据,如果存在则将数据填充到相应的输入框中。...,这样当输入框中输入内容,会自动触发保存数据的操作。...当输入内容,saveData() 函数会被触发,并将输入框的保存到本地存储中。同时,通过在代码中添加console.log()语句,保存成功的消息输出到控制台

    9510

    不懂SpringApplication生命周期事件?那就等于不会Spring Boot嘛

    完成的大事 监听此事件的监听器们 总结 关注A哥 ?...事件触发对应的监听器的执行 ---- 监听此事件的监听器们 默认情况下,有4个监听器监听ApplicationStartingEvent事件: ?...发送ApplicationEnvironmentPreparedEvent事件触发对应的监听器的执行 对环境抽象Enviroment的填,均是由监听此事件的监听器去完成,见下面的监听器详解 bindToSpringApplication...对错误的配置进行警告(不会终止程序),以warn()日志输出在控制台。...---- 完成的大事 得到异常的退出码ExitCode,然后发送ExitCodeEvent事件(非生命周期事件) 发送ApplicationFailedEvent事件触发对应的监听器的执行 ----

    1.3K30

    急速 debug 实战一(浏览器-基础篇)

    方法 3:控制台 除了查看 console.log() 消息以外,您还可以使用控制台对任意 JavaScript 语句求值。 对于调试,您可以使用控制台测试错误的潜在解决方法。...XHR 当 XHR 网址包含字符串模式事件侦听器 在触发 click 等事件后运行的代码中。 异常 在引发已捕获或未捕获异常的代码行中。 函数 任何时候调用特定函数。...DevTools 会在 XHR 的请求网址的任意位置显示此字符串暂停。 按 Enter 键以确认。 事件侦听器断点 如果想要暂停触发事件后运行的事件侦听器代码,可以使用事件侦听器断点。...DevTools 会显示 Animation 等事件类别列表。 勾选这些类别之一以在触发该类别的任何事件暂停,或者展开类别并勾选特定事件。 ?...如果是从 DevTools 控制台中调用 debug(),则很难确保目标函数在范围内。 下面介绍一个策略: 在函数在范围内设置代码行断点。 触发此断点。

    3.3K10

    浏览器的线程有哪些?

    3.事件触发线程 归属于浏览器而不是JS引擎,用来控制事件循环(可以理解,JS引擎自己都忙不过来,需要浏览器另开线程协助) 当JS引擎执行代码块如setTimeOut(也可来自浏览器内核的其他线程,如鼠标点击...、AJAX异步请求等),会将对应任务添加到事件线程中 当对应的事件符合触发条件被触发,该线程会把事件添加到待处理队列的队尾,等待JS引擎的处理 注意,由于JS的单线程关系,所以这些待处理队列中的事件都得排队等待...JS引擎处理(当JS引擎空闲时才会去执行) 4.定时触发器线程 传说中的setInterval与setTimeout所在线程 浏览器定时计数器并不是由JavaScript引擎计数的,(因为JavaScript...引擎是单线程的, 如果处于阻塞线程状态就会影响计时的准确) 因此通过单独线程来计时并触发定时(计时完毕后,添加到事件队列中,等待JS引擎空闲后执行) 注意,W3C在HTML标准中规定,规定要求setTimeout...5.异步http请求线程 在XMLHttpRequest在连接后是通过浏览器新开一个线程请求 检测到状态变更,如果设置有回调函数,异步线程就产生状态变更事件这个回调再放入事件队列中。

    80020

    你不知道的 Web Workers

    阅读完本文你学到以下知识: 进程与线程的区别:进程与线程的概念及单线程与多线程; 浏览器内核的相关知识:GUI 渲染线程、JavaScript 引擎线程、事件触发线程等; Web Workers 是什么...2.3 事件触发线程 当一个事件触发该线程会把事件添加到待处理队列的队尾,等待 JavaScript 引擎的处理。...2.4 定时触发器线程 浏览器定时计数器并不是由 JavaScript 引擎计数的,这是因为 JavaScript 引擎是单线程的,如果处于阻塞线程状态就会影响计时的准确,所以通过单独线程来计时并触发定时是更为合理的方案...2.5 Http 异步请求线程 在 XMLHttpRequest 在连接后是通过浏览器新开一个线程请求, 检测到状态变更,如果设置有回调函数,异步线程就产生状态变更事件放到 JavaScript 引擎的处理队列中等待处理...Worker.onmessageerror:指定 messageerror 事件的监听函数。发送的数据无法序列化成字符串,会触发这个事件

    1.4K10

    3个月时间,5名黑客找出苹果55个漏洞,赚了5万多美元,还写了篇博客记录全程

    但是在新冠疫情的影响下,我们有了很多额外的空闲时间,最终累积下来,每个人平均投入了数百小。” ? 不过,在这次的事件上,比起黑客们发现的漏洞,人们对于苹果给予的奖金数额更感兴趣。...但是,苹果却告诉他们和大众,这一切只5万,这让我不得其解,并且这与他们所宣扬的严肃对待隐私和安全问题的说法背道而驰。”...当你提交了包括用户名、姓名、邮箱地址和雇主在内的申请,你也在提交一个 "密码 ",这个密码从页面上的一个隐藏的输入字段被秘密地绑定到你的账户上。...当我们最终找到并加载管理控制台,障碍又出现了。我们无法使用一般的功能来演示远程代码执行(没有模板、插件上传,也没有标准的管理调试功能)。 ?...第二个XSS的影响与第一个XSS相同,不同之处在于,用户必须通过鼠标置于电子邮件正文中的某个位置来触发onmouseover事件处理程序,但是可以通过制作整个电子邮件的超链接简化此部分以使其更容易触发

    71251

    【Java 进阶篇】JavaScript 事件详解

    最终,我们提供大量的示例代码来帮助您更好地理解JavaScript事件。 什么是事件? 在Web开发中,事件是用户或浏览器发生的事情。...mouseup:鼠标按钮被释放触发。 2. 键盘事件 keydown:键盘上的键被按下触发。 keyup:键盘上的键被释放触发。 3. 表单事件 submit:表单提交触发。...change:表单元素的发生改变触发。 input:输入框的内容发生变化时触发。 4. 网页加载事件 load:整个页面及外部资源加载完成触发。...事件处理程序 事件处理程序是JavaScript函数,它定义了事件触发要执行的操作。事件处理程序通常带有一个事件对象参数,以便访问事件的相关信息。...因此,控制台输出以下内容: 子元素被点击 父元素被点击 您可以使用stopPropagation方法来阻止事件继续冒泡: child.addEventListener('click', function

    25840
    领券